CTEK Inc., a leading global brand in the care and maintenance of vehicle batteries, has published a new product guide that covers the company’s chargers, power management systems, and related accessories. The CTEK 2018 North American Product Guide includes products for both the consumer and professional users, and also has power management products for off-road/RV enthusiasts.

The CTEK Product Guide is available for download at https://smartercharger.com/product-guide/.

The 28-page guide gives detailed descriptions of the products available for North America and also includes a quick reference guide for selecting the right charger for any application. A section at the front details how CTEK chargers maximize battery life with proprietary charging and maintenance stages, using microprocessor controlled charging processes.

The guide includes information on the new CT5 TIME TO GO charger, which was selected by Auto Express magazine as “Best Battery Charger,” the fourth time a CTEK charger has received this distinction. The CT5 TIME TO GO, due to launch in North America very shortly, takes a different approach by telling users how long it will take until the battery is charged and ready to go.
